Supporters stood with Atlanta Mayor Keisha Lance Bottoms Monday as she signed legislation aimed at closing the Atlanta City Detention Center.

“It has always been a vision of mine to close the Atlanta city jail. The city detention center is the first step for people to gain records and a background for not committing a crime but for violating a city ordinance…no one should be harshly penalized for that - only receive a citation,” stated Marilynn Winn.


Winn is the executive director of Women on the Rise – a grassroots organization led by formally incarcerated women of color. The group is one of several a part of an alliance to close of the city jail.  

Listen as Winn and Devin Barrington-Ward – with advocacy organization Close the Jail ATL – discuss the 25 member task force and future plans to utilize the space.
